Executive Overview
Thryv (NASDAQ: THRY) is a global provider of small business management software and marketing solutions designed to help small-to-medium-sized businesses (SMBs) compete with larger corporations. Headquartered in Dallas, Texas, the company has a long history of supporting local businesses, evolving from its roots in directory services (formerly DexYP) into a comprehensive SaaS provider.
Thryv’s flagship product is an integrated platform that combines essential business functions into a single interface. These functions include customer relationship management (CRM), appointment scheduling, billing and payments, social media management, and online reputation management. The company primarily serves service-based industries such as home services (HVAC, plumbing, roofing), professional services (legal, accounting), and health/wellness providers.
With a market presence spanning the United States, Canada, and Australia, Thryv has established itself as a leader in the SMB SaaS space. The company’s growth strategy is focused on migrating its extensive legacy client base to its cloud-based platform while aggressively acquiring new customers through a robust direct sales force and strategic partnerships. Thryv’s overall business focus is to provide a "business-in-a-box" solution that allows entrepreneurs to spend less time on administrative tasks and more time serving their customers. Product Offerings
Thryv offers a scalable product suite tailored to different business stages:
- Thryv Command Center: A free-to-start tier that provides a centralized inbox, basic CRM, and team communication tools to get businesses organized.
- Thryv Business Center: The core all-in-one platform. It includes the full CRM, scheduling, marketing automation, reputation management, and payment processing. This is the standard choice for most service-based SMBs.
- Thryv Marketing Center: A specialized module focused on customer acquisition, offering advanced tools for ad management, landing pages, and detailed marketing analytics to track ROI on lead spend.
- Thryv Multi-Location: Designed for franchises or businesses with multiple branches, providing a "bird's eye view" of performance across all locations while allowing local managers to handle daily operations.
- App Market Add-ons: Specialized integrations and extended features (like HIPAA) that can be toggled on based on industry requirements.
Product Differentiation
The primary differentiator of the Thryv platform is its "all-in-one" architecture, which eliminates the "app fatigue" that often plagues small business owners. Rather than forcing users to integrate disparate tools for CRM, scheduling, and payments, Thryv provides a unified command center. Key product differentiators include:
* **Centralized Communication:** Thryv’s "Command Center" unifies messages from SMS, email, GMB, and social media into a single thread, ensuring no customer inquiry is missed.
* **End-to-End Client Journey:** The platform covers the entire lifecycle, from initial lead capture and automated estimates to online scheduling, secure payment processing, and automated review generation.
* **Integrated Marketing Center:** Unlike generic CRMs, Thryv includes sophisticated local marketing tools, including automated social media posting, business listing management across 60+ directories, and targeted email/SMS marketing campaigns.
* **ThryvPay:** A proprietary payment gateway specifically designed for service providers, offering competitive rates, convenience fees, and scheduled recurring payments tailored to the way small businesses operate.
* **Mobile-First Design:** Recognizing that service providers are often in the field, the platform is optimized for mobile management, allowing business owners to send invoices or update schedules from a job site.
By consolidating these features, Thryv reduces the total cost of ownership and technical complexity for businesses that lack dedicated IT or marketing departments.
